Sedation dentistry or sleep dentistry is a
part of modern dentistry that uses sedative
medications or drugs to calm and relax
patients before or during dental procedures.
These medications depress the central
nervous system in the patient, triggering a
minimal, moderate, or completely
unconscious state.

Different Levels of Sedation
There are four different levels of sedation. Dentists
may put you in any of these sedation levels as per
the requirement of the dental procedure and your
anxiety level.
Minimal Sedation: You are conscious, but you are
relaxed.
Moderate Sedation:You are partly unconscious
and your words may slur while speaking.
Deep Sedation:You are almost unconscious but
can be awakened.
General Anesthesia:You are completely
unconscious.
Common Dental Procedures That May Require
Sedation Dentistry
Many dental procedures are painful and require
sedation dentistry. Some of those include:
Dental Extractions/ Tooth Removal
Dental Implants
Dental Surgeries
Root Canal
Bone Grafting
Dental Emergencies
Depending on the seriousness of the dental problem
and the level of fear and stress in the patient,
patients are given different levels of sedation.
Is Sedation Dentistry Completely Safe?
When administered by a sedation specialist or
qualified dentist, the use of sedative
medications before or during dental procedures
is completely safe. The sedative medications are
given after checking and analyzing the medical
history of the patient. The patients can take
sedative drugs in different methods, including:
Orally
Inhaling Nitrous Oxide
Intravenously (injecting a sedative drug directly
to the vein)
